编程学什么比较高端的好
-
编程是一个广泛应用于各个行业和领域的技能,掌握高端的编程技术可以为你的职业发展打下坚实的基础。那么,学习哪些高端的编程技术可以让你走在行业的前沿呢?
-
人工智能和机器学习:人工智能和机器学习是当前炙手可热的领域,掌握这些技术可以为你在数据分析、模式识别、自然语言处理等方面提供强大的能力。学习Python语言和相关的机器学习库,如TensorFlow和PyTorch,是入门人工智能和机器学习的好方式。
-
大数据和数据科学:随着互联网和物联网的迅猛发展,大数据分析成为企业决策和业务优化的重要手段。学习大数据技术和数据科学算法,例如Hadoop、Spark和数据挖掘,可以使你能够处理和分析大规模的数据集。
-
嵌入式系统和物联网:随着物联网的兴起,嵌入式系统的需求也越来越大。学习嵌入式系统的编程和硬件知识,可以使你能够开发和控制各种智能设备和传感器,如智能家居、智能车辆等。
-
虚拟现实和增强现实:虚拟现实和增强现实是近年来发展迅猛的技术领域,涉及到图形处理、人机交互等多个方面。学习相关的编程语言和框架,如Unity和Unreal Engine,可以让你开发出令人惊叹的虚拟现实和增强现实应用。
-
区块链和加密货币:区块链是一种分布式账本技术,已经在金融、供应链等领域产生了重大影响。学习区块链的编程和智能合约开发,可以为你在区块链行业找到更多的机会。
总结来说,学习人工智能和机器学习、大数据和数据科学、嵌入式系统和物联网、虚拟现实和增强现实、区块链和加密货币等高端编程技术,可以让你在职业发展中走在行业的前沿,为你的未来打下坚实的基础。
1年前 -
-
学习高端编程技术可以帮助开发人员在竞争激烈的市场中脱颖而出,提高自己的技术水平和就业竞争力。以下是几个比较高端的编程领域和技术,可以作为学习的方向:
-
人工智能和机器学习:人工智能和机器学习是当前最热门和高端的编程领域之一。学习人工智能和机器学习可以帮助开发人员构建智能系统、模式识别和预测分析等应用。常用的编程语言包括Python和R。
-
大数据和数据科学:随着数据量的爆炸性增长,大数据和数据科学的需求也越来越高。学习大数据技术可以帮助开发人员处理和分析大规模数据集,提取有价值的信息。学习Hadoop、Spark和SQL等技术可以帮助开发人员进入这个领域。
-
嵌入式系统和物联网:嵌入式系统和物联网是连接物理世界和网络的关键技术。学习嵌入式系统和物联网可以帮助开发人员构建智能设备和系统,如智能家居、智能城市和智能工厂。学习C/C++和嵌入式开发平台如Arduino和Raspberry Pi等可以入门这个领域。
-
虚拟现实和增强现实:虚拟现实和增强现实是近年来兴起的技术,正在改变人们的交互方式和体验。学习虚拟现实和增强现实可以帮助开发人员构建沉浸式的虚拟环境和增强现实应用。学习Unity3D和C#等技术可以进入这个领域。
-
区块链技术:区块链技术是一种去中心化的分布式账本技术,正在改变金融、供应链和数据安全等领域。学习区块链技术可以帮助开发人员构建安全可靠的区块链应用。学习Solidity和智能合约等技术可以入门这个领域。
无论选择哪个高端编程技术,都需要持续学习和实践,跟上技术的快速发展。同时,还可以参加相关的培训课程、参与开源项目和参加技术社区,与其他开发人员交流和学习,不断提升自己的技术水平。
1年前 -
-
编程是一个广泛的领域,涵盖了许多不同的编程语言、框架和技术。要学习一门高端的编程语言或技术,需要考虑以下几个方面:
-
目标和兴趣:首先要确定你想要学习哪个领域的编程,例如移动应用开发、网络安全、人工智能等。然后考虑你对这个领域的兴趣和热情。选择一个你感兴趣的领域,可以提高学习的积极性和动力。
-
市场需求:了解目前市场上对哪些编程语言和技术有需求。可以通过查阅招聘网站、行业报告等了解市场的趋势和需求。选择一个市场需求较高的编程语言或技术,可以增加就业机会和职业发展的可能性。
-
学习曲线:考虑学习一门高端的编程语言或技术的难度。有些编程语言或技术可能需要更多的时间和精力来学习和掌握。根据自己的学习能力和时间安排,选择适合自己的学习曲线。
以下是一些比较高端的编程语言和技术,供你参考:
-
人工智能和机器学习:Python是目前人工智能和机器学习领域最流行的编程语言之一。它具有丰富的科学计算库和机器学习框架,如TensorFlow和PyTorch。学习Python和机器学习算法可以帮助你进入人工智能和机器学习领域。
-
大数据和数据科学:Hadoop和Spark是目前最常用的大数据处理框架。学习这些框架可以帮助你处理和分析大规模的数据集。此外,R语言也是数据科学领域常用的编程语言,它具有丰富的统计分析库和可视化工具。
-
前端开发:JavaScript是用于前端开发的最常用的编程语言。学习JavaScript可以帮助你构建交互式的网页和Web应用程序。此外,React和Angular是目前流行的JavaScript框架,可以帮助你构建复杂的前端应用。
-
后端开发:Java是一种广泛应用于企业级应用开发的编程语言。学习Java可以帮助你构建安全、可靠的后端系统。此外,Python和Node.js也是后端开发的流行选择,它们具有简洁的语法和丰富的库。
-
区块链开发:区块链是一种去中心化的分布式技术,学习区块链开发可以帮助你构建安全和可信的应用程序。Solidity是用于以太坊平台的智能合约开发的编程语言。
无论你选择学习哪门高端的编程语言或技术,记住坚持学习和实践是关键。不断地练习和实践,参与项目和开发实践,才能真正掌握和应用所学的知识。
1年前 -